What beer do they drink in Kdramas?

After bingeing on countless Korean dramas and K-pop songs, we’ve become well aware of the magic powers of soju. If you haven’t been initiated, well, soju is a traditional Korean distilled beverage made from rice, wheat, or barley, usually containing about 16.8% to 53% alcohol by volume.

What are they drinking in Korean dramas?

In South Korean dramas, the primary drink of choice is soju. The Lonely Planet Guide to Korea describes it as: “a robust drink distilled from rice, yams or tapioca, and potent as toilet bowl cleanser.” It is normally a clear, colorless liquid sold in green glass bottles of 375ml, or larger plastic bottles.

Do they really drink alcohol in Korean dramas?

“Drunken scenes” almost always appear in Korean dramas and movies. Most of the actors pretend to be drunk and act, but rarely do they really drink and shoot.

Do Koreans drink a lot?

South Koreans drink 13.7 shots of liquor per week on average, which is the most in the world. And of 44 other countries analyzed by Euromonitor, none comes anywhere close. South Korea’s unparalleled liquor consumption is almost entirely due to the country’s love for a certain fermented rice spirit called Soju.

What does makgeolli taste like?

Makgeolli can have a range of tastes, and indeed your drinking Makgeolli experience will likely go on a unique taste journey through many of them. Sweet, sour, tangy, creamy, bitter, fruity, floral, notes all topped off with a bit of a chalky dusting.

How many episodes are there in a Korean drama?

In sum, most Korean dramas have 16 to 20 one hour-long episodes (cable TV) or 32 to 40 half-hour-long episodes (terrestrial TV) that air for 8 to 10 weeks. There are dramas with only 12 (Voice 2), 8 (Lingerie Girls’ Generation), and 4 (The Most Beautiful Goodbye In The World) hour-long episodes.
